Australians see inflation dropping to 2.5% in the 12 months through the end of December, a low last seen in late 2003. Consumers have consecutively expected the price of goods in the South Pacific country to decline since July. The plunge in crude and gas prices have seen since July have strongly contributed to the sharp change in expectations.
Quarterly inflation itself has also fallen, to 1.2% in the third quarter alone, a substantial decline from the previous estimate of 1.5%.
